Finance review: the proposed outsourcing of Tier 1 support to Bravenor Services would reduce annual support cost by roughly 18%, assuming stable ticket volumes. Transition costs are front-loaded in the first two quarters. Quality clawbacks are contractually secured. Risks centre on handover attrition. The rationale tying this to our wider direction is set out below.

confidential, bahof-yaweg: Headcount on the Kaseth team goes from 32 to 109 by the end of January. Gross margin on Kaseth came in at 46 percent against a plan of 45 percent.

- [ ] Step 7: Archive cold storage buckets (Glacierline tier). Confirm both ceremony witnesses are present, verify bucket manifests match the Oxbow ledger, then seal the archive key shares. Plugin authors may observe but not handle shares. Once sealed, the archive index itself is encrypted and can only be reopened with the passphrase below.

vault phrase of badup-hahig = tamael-aldael-kelmir-istael-fenok-istwyn-tamius-jorath-oliion

Handover: Matchwell GC pauses

Hey, welcome aboard! Quick brain dump before I'm out. The Matchwell matching service has been hitting 800ms GC pauses under peak load — mostly old-gen churn from the order-book snapshots. Tuning notes are in the wiki; short version: we bumped heap regions and it mostly behaves now. Watch the pause dashboard Mondays. To unlock the tuning vault, use the passphrase below.

unlock words, hahip-baduf: holwyn-istath-julvan

## Capacity Note: Tidemark Export Timezones

Plugin authors: Tidemark report exports now resolve timezones server-side. Each export job pre-computes offset tables per requested zone, which costs memory proportional to zone count. Keep distinct zones per job low; jobs exceeding the cap are split, doubling queue time. DST transition windows add a fixed per-job surcharge. We sized the Q2 fleet against these assumptions, so plan accordingly. Current limits are:

tuning table, yajog-yahof:
BUDGETS = {
    "lamvan": 303,
    "wenox": 460,
    "fenvan": 525,
}